If you’re into photo wallpapers (as opposed to abstract or 3d rendered ones for example) Unsplash is great.

It’s a website, but they also have an app. It’s a completely free stock photo website, except the photos don’t suck like stock photos usually do lol

ArtStation is another good one if you’re into more paintings and renders as wallpapers. It’s an app for artists to share their work, but you can just save/screenshot the images you like and use them as wallpapers.

As an artist myself, I promise you 99% of artists don’t care if you do that as long as it’s just for your personal use.
